Description:
The STM32F405xx and STM32F407xx family is based on the high-performance Arm®Cortex®-M4 32-bit RISC core operating at a frequency of up to 168 MHz. The Cortex®-M4core features a floating-point unit (FPU) single precision which supports all Arm singleprecision data-processing instructions and data types. It also implements a full set of DSPinstructions and a memory protection unit (MPU) which enhances application security.The STM32F405xx and STM32F407xx family incorporates high-speed embeddedmemories (flash memory up to 1 Mbyte, up to 192 Kbytes of SRAM), up to 4 Kbytes ofbackup SRAM, and an extensive range of enhanced I/Os and peripherals connected to twoAPB buses, three AHB buses and a 32-bit multi-AHB bus matrix.
All devices offer three 12-bit ADCs, two DACs, a low-power RTC, 12 general-purpose 16-bittimers including two PWM timers for motor control, two general-purpose 32-bit timers. a truerandom number generator (RNG). They also feature standard and advancedcommunication interfaces.
• Up to three I2Cs
• Three SPIs, two I2Ss full duplex. To achieve audio class accuracy, the I2S peripheralscan be clocked via a dedicated internal audio PLL or via an external clock to allowsynchronization
• Four USARTs plus two UARTs
• A USB OTG full speed and a USB OTG high speed with full-speed capability (with theULPI)
• Two CANs
• An SDIO/MMC interface
• Ethernet and the camera interface available on STM32F407xx devices only
Features:
• Includes ST state-of-the-art patentedtechnology
• Core: Arm® 32-bit Cortex®-M4 CPU with FPU,Adaptive real-time accelerator (ARTAccelerator) allowing 0-wait state executionfrom flash memory, frequency up to 168 MHz,memory protection unit, 210 DMIPS/1.25 DMIPS/MHz (Dhrystone 2.1), and DSPinstructions
• Memories
– Up to 1 Mbyte of flash memory
– Up to 192+4 Kbytes of SRAM including 64-Kbyte of CCM (core coupled memory) dataRAM
– 512 bytes of OTP memory
– Flexible static memory controllersupporting Compact Flash, SRAM,PSRAM, NOR and NAND memories
• LCD parallel interface, 8080/6800 modes
• Clock, reset, and supply management
– 1.8 V to 3.6 V application supply and I/Os
– POR, PDR, PVD and BOR
– 4-to-26 MHz crystal oscillator
– Internal 16 MHz factory-trimmed RC (1%accuracy)
– 32 kHz oscillator for RTC with calibration
– Internal 32 kHz RC with calibration
• Low-power operation
– Sleep, Stop, and Standby modes
– VBAT supply for RTC, 20×32-bit backupregisters + optional 4 KB backup SRAM
• 3×12-bit, 2.4 MSPS A/D converters: up to 24channels and 7.2 MSPS in triple interleavedmode
• 2×12-bit D/A converters
• General-purpose DMA: 16-stream DMAcontroller with FIFOs and burst support
• Up to 17 timers: up to twelve 16-bit and two 32-bit timers up to 168 MHz, each with up to 4IC/OC/PWM or pulse counter and quadrature(incremental) encoder input
• Debug mode
– Serial wire debug (SWD) & JTAGinterfaces
– Cortex-M4 Embedded Trace Macrocell™
• Up to 140 I/O ports with interrupt capability
– Up to 136 fast I/Os up to 84 MHz
– Up to 138 5 V-tolerant I/Os
• Up to 15 communication interfaces
– Up to 3 × I2C interfaces (SMBus/PMBus)
– Up to 4 USARTs/2 UARTs (10.5 Mbit/s, ISO7816 interface, LIN, IrDA, modem control)
– Up to 3 SPIs (42 Mbits/s), 2 with muxedfull-duplex I2S to achieve audio classaccuracy via internal audio PLL or externalclock
– 2 × CAN interfaces (2.0B Active)
– SDIO interface
• Advanced connectivity
– USB 2.0 full-speed device/host/OTGcontroller with on-chip PHY
– USB 2.0 high-speed/full-speeddevice/host/OTG controller with dedicatedDMA, on-chip full-speed PHY and ULPI
– 10/100 Ethernet MAC with dedicated DMA:supports IEEE 1588v2 hardware, MII/RMII
